Bug Description

Binary package hint: ntfs-3g

The summary pretty much says it all. I'm trying to copy my Thunderbird files from XP to Ubuntu, but I get a "Permission Denied" error every time. I can't even copy the files to a flash drive. I've tried doing a sudo cp but still get the same error.

Nautilus is standard x64 in Jaunty. I've added ntfs-config tool. I've also tried setting permissions for the folder. I don't have problems copying other things (so far).

Thank you for your bug report. Could you please post the output of "mount -l"? Could you also try copying using the terminal? If that doesn't work, please post the exact command you used and the error messages as they appear.
